Politics has a direct impact on investment decision-making in the Argentine agricultural sector, affecting each of its links, and this was demonstrated in the market for the buying and selling of fields. According to the latest report from the Argentine Chamber of Rural Real Estate (CAIR), during October, the month in which the ruling party obtained a resounding victory in the national legislative elections, the level of activity in the sector resumed its upward trend, boosting the search for agricultural and livestock fields. In fact, the "Index of activity in the rural real estate market" (InCAIR), prepared by the business chamber, climbed in October to 56.48 points, matching the August mark, which was the highest of the year, and recovered from the sharp drop it had in September, following the triumph of Peronism in the Buenos Aires provincial elections.
